Monnickendam is a city located in the Netherlands, specifically in the province of North Holland. Its GPS coordinates are 52.45833, 5.0375, placing it just north of Amsterdam. Monnickendam is situated along the IJsselmeer, a significant body of water that has historically been vital for fishing and trade.
The city is known for its picturesque harbor, well-preserved medieval architecture, and charming canals, which attract visitors seeking a quaint Dutch experience. Monnickendam is also recognized for its local seafood and traditional wooden houses, showcasing the region’s maritime heritage. The city operates within the Europe/Amsterdam timezone, aligning it with the capital and other major cities in the Netherlands.
Regionally, Monnickendam serves as a gateway to exploring the scenic landscapes of North Holland and offers easy access to surrounding areas, enhancing its significance as a tranquil retreat from the bustling city life of Amsterdam.
Timezone in Monnickendam
Monnickendam is located in the Europe/Amsterdam timezone, which has a standard UTC offset of +1 hour. During daylight saving time, which begins on the last Sunday in March and ends on the last Sunday in October, the offset shifts to UTC +2 hours. This means that from late March to late October, Monnickendam is one hour ahead of its standard time.

Attractions and Activities in Monnickendam
Monnickendam is a charming town in the Netherlands, located in the province of North Holland, near the Markermeer lake. Known for its picturesque canals and historic buildings, Monnickendam reflects the region’s rich maritime history. The town features several well-preserved 17th-century houses, which showcase traditional Dutch architecture, and the old harbor is a focal point for both residents and visitors.
One of the notable attractions in Monnickendam is the St. Nicholas Church, which dates back to the 14th century. This church, with its striking tower, is an essential part of the town’s skyline.
The town also hosts a variety of cultural events throughout the year, including local markets and festivals that celebrate its fishing heritage. The surrounding area is characterized by scenic landscapes and water bodies, making it ideal for cycling and walking. Monnickendam serves as a gateway to exploring the broader region of Waterland, known for its quaint villages and natural beauty.
Practical Information for Visitors
Monnickendam is easily accessible from Amsterdam, with the nearest airport being Amsterdam Schiphol, located about 30 kilometers away. From the airport, you can take a train to Amsterdam Central Station and then catch a bus or a ferry to Monnickendam. Alternatively, direct buses from Amsterdam are available, making it convenient for visitors.
The climate in Monnickendam is characterized by mild summers and cool winters. The best time to visit is during the late spring and early summer, particularly from May to August, when the weather is generally pleasant and suitable for outdoor activities. Rain is possible throughout the year, so packing an umbrella or a waterproof jacket is advisable.
